Latest Patents

Among her latest patents is a groundbreaking method for treating fibromyalgia, which utilizes N-methyl-3-(1-naphthalenyloxy)-3-(2-thienyl)propanamine to alleviate persistent pain. Additionally, she has developed a method for treating pain that involves administering an analgesic composition comprising duloxetine along with one or more NSAIDs or acetaminophen.
